Chicago officer completes swimming’s Triple Crown

Associated Press

CHICAGO — English Channel? Check. Swimming around Manhattan Island? Yep.

On Tuesday, Chicago police officer Nial Funchion checked off another grueling swim, traversing the channel between Catalina Island and the Southern California coast.

And with that he became one of only about 70 athletes to complete what’s known as the Triple Crown of open water swimming.

The routes represent a combined 70-plus miles.

Funchion tells the Chicago Sun-Times he was motivated by a former police colleague who was paralyzed in a car accident.

During a chance meeting three years ago, the fellow officer told Funchion that he admired him for swimming the English Channel in 1992.

Funchion dedicated his latest swim to the Brotherhood for the Fallen. The Chicago organization helps families of officers killed in the line of duty.
